<br />WHEREAS, the undersigned, Five Points Bank, a Nebraska Corporation, as Trustee, under
<br />the Deed of Trust dated March 27, 2000, executed by Henry A. Swanson and Carla R. Swanson,
<br />Husband and Wife, as Trustor, in which Five Points Bank is named as Beneficiary, and the
<br />undersigned as Trustee, which was recorded in the office of the Register of Deeds, Hall County,
<br />Nebraska, on April 5, 2000, recorded as Document No. 200002662 and
<br />WHEREAS, said undersigned, Five Points Bank, as Trustee, has received from Five Points
<br />Bank, as Beneficiary, written request to reconvey the real estate described in the Deed of Trust
<br />above mentioned as follows:
<br />Lots Thirty -seven (37) and Thirty-eight (38), Belmont Addition to the City of Grand Island, Hall County,
<br />Nebraska.
<br />said request to reconvey reciting that all sums secured by such Deed of Trust have been fully paid;
<br />NOW THEREFORE, in accordance with such request and the provisions of such Deed of
<br />Trust, the undersigned as Trustee, does hereby reconvey, without warranty, to the person or persons
<br />legally entitled thereto, the estate now held by said Trustee hereunder.
<br />IN WITNESS WHEREOF, the undersigned has executed this Deed of Reconveyance, at
<br />Grand Island, Nebraska, this 8t" of February, 2005.
